Output 5ebacb98dcb6e21d10cfbfd7cb2f45803fe3d8e36d4ed95c7c6756e22b6c347f:0

value
8340000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56cc9000cb63b7b5cd6c32620d539d6001ad1739 OP_EQUAL
address
39by6HzDZkZLSeXyvShBa1DNy6iTagVH8E
transaction
5ebacb98dcb6e21d10cfbfd7cb2f45803fe3d8e36d4ed95c7c6756e22b6c347f
spent
true